WebFeb 24, 2024 · An Aboriginal business that is subcontracted by a bidder must also meet the same eligibility criteria as the Aboriginal business submitting the bid. To enforce the eligibility criteria for subcontractors, the bidding organization must request proof of the subcontractor's eligibility and authorize an audit performed by Canada to verify the records.
